From: Frank Rowand <redacted>

Non-overlay dynamic devicetree node removal may leave the node in
the phandle cache.  Subsequent calls to of_find_node_by_phandle()
will incorrectly find the stale entry.  This bug exposed the foloowing
phandle cache refcount bug.

The refcount of phandle_cache entries is not incremented while in
the cache, allowing use after free error after kfree() of the
cached entry.

Changes since v1:
  - make __of_free_phandle_cache() static
  - add WARN_ON(1) for unexpected condition in of_find_node_by_phandle()

Frank Rowand (2):
  of: of_node_get()/of_node_put() nodes held in phandle cache
  of: __of_detach_node() - remove node from phandle cache
